> Please consider adding avahi-daemon as a dependency to gnome-control-center 
> or one of its dependencies, whatever makes more sense.

Thank you for taking the time to report this bug.

We can fix this, but you would not have been affected by this bug if
you installed recommended dependencies. gnome-control-center
recommends gnome-user-share which depends on libapache2-mod-dnssd
which depends on avahi-daemon.

Please don't disable installing recommends and please take a look at
the list of recommended packages below that you don't have installed.
You are missing out on important gnome-control-center features.
